  2. Clark University is a private research university in Worcester, Massachusetts. Founded in 1887 with a large endowment from its namesake Jonas Gilman Clark, a prominent businessman, Clark was one of the first modern research universities in the United States.

  7. Admissions Deadlines. Clark accepts the Common App and the Coalition App with Scoir, and offers multiple application options for first-year students: Early Decision I, Early Decision II, Early Action, and Regular Decision. Transfer applications are due later, and decisions are distributed within two to four weeks.
